I've noticed in the past on Hacker News comment threads about Amazon AWS, or other cloud services, that a common theme is that "EC2 is expensive, just buy a dedicated server from OVH/Hetzner!"

This is why some use EC2: it is trivial to snapshot and backup block storage, it is cheap to store snapshots, and recovery from a catastrophic hardware crash will take minutes.
